Personalizing Spaces with Mosaic Stone

Mosaic stone is not only about aesthetics but also about personalizing spaces. From bathroom walls and kitchen backsplashes to flooring and artistic focal points, mosaic stone allows users to express their creativity in a refined manner. By selecting colors, shapes, and stone arrangements, one can transform a space into a unique work of art.
